With the development of system reform, the unpublicized, unfair and wrongmalady in the promotion of Section-chief-rank Civil Servant is gradually showing.The public is discontented with some official lings’ speedy promotion. The study onthe Mechanism for the promotion of civil servants is the area which political,economic, social, management and other disciplines pay close attention to. TheSection-chief-rank Civil Servants take large number, have very wide classes, rank low,and have many structured types. The strategy they take for promotion and results theycompete will negate or strengthen the choice they make for promotion. This madehuge impact on the whole bureaucracy system, and then it may affect the run ofeconomy and society. Because the public servant system was carried out in China foronly a short time, and the laws were not fully followed in the process of promotion ofcivil servant, it requires reform necessarily and realistically.This thesis is carding to Section-chief-rank Civil Servant combed the promotionof existing institutional arrangements, analyzing the impact of policy selectedinstitutional factors and non-institutional factors for Section-chief-rank Civil Servantand the intrinsic link between them, according to public servant law and theregulation of selecting to appoint of the public servant of party and governmentleading posts which our country has promulgated and put into effect and other lawsand regulations. This thesis builds relatively complex framework about game modeland impact factor model for section-level promotion strategies of Section-chief-rankCivil Servant, by synthetically using economic, sociology, political science,management science related theories, on the basis of "political theater", promotion thegame and the Peter Principle traps. Through using the media reported news eventsand cases interviewed by author, It is found by analysis Section-chief-rank CivilServant combed the promotion of existing institutional arrangements from five levelsof the central state organs, provincial authorities, municipal authorities, counties(cities, districts) organs, township (street), which conducive to the allocation ofresources to play a promotion and incentive functions, but also leading to the reverseelimination, disorderly competition, non-performance behavior, corruption and othernegative effects. This thesis put forward general ideas about management reform fromthe promotion of Section-chief-rank Civil Servant in circumvent the "system trap" and weaken "social relations" two aspects, and put forward three specific measures fromthe expanded career paths, standardized promotion procedures, and strengthenmonitoring mechanisms.
